Understanding Termite Habits
To recognize termite actions, observe their patterns of motion and feeding routines carefully. Termites are social pests that interact in big swarms to forage for food. They interact with pheromones, which help them collaborate their activities and situate food resources successfully. As they look for cellulose-rich products to feed upon, termites produce distinctive tunnels and mud tubes to shield themselves from predators and keep a stable atmosphere.
Termites are most active throughout warmer months when they can conveniently access food resources and replicate quickly. They're brought in to damp and rotting timber, making homes with dampness concerns especially at risk to problems. By recognizing their behavior, you can recognize possible entrance points and take safety nets to secure your home.
Keep an eye out for indications of termite task, such as thrown out wings, mud tubes, and hollow-sounding timber. By being aggressive and resolving any kind of issues without delay, you can minimize the threat of termite damage and ensure the lasting integrity of your home.

Effective Termite Therapy Options
Take into consideration carrying out targeted termite treatments to eradicate existing problems and avoid future termite damages. When taking care of termite problems, it's crucial to pick the most reliable therapy alternatives readily available.
Below are some referrals to aid you tackle your termite trouble properly:
- ** Fluid Termiticides **: Applied to the soil around the border of your home, fluid termiticides produce a protective barrier that prevents termites from going into the framework.
- ** Bait Stations **: Lure stations are purposefully positioned around your property to attract termites. When termites prey on the lure, they bring it back to their nest, properly eliminating the entire termite population.
- ** Wood Treatments **: Timber treatments involve applying specialized items straight to infested wood or vulnerable locations. These therapies can help get rid of existing termites and safeguard against future invasions.
